Outline of Final Research Achievements

Thanks to the observational progress on cosmology, the so-called 'standard cosmological model', which consistently describes the dynamics of cosmic expansion and growth of structure, has been fully established. Since the cosmology in the coming decade is also expected to be driven by the precision observational data set from the systematic large-scale surveys, a development of accurate theoretical template, which will be used to extract the cosmological information from the observational data, is quite crucial. For this purpose, based on the perturbation theory technique of large-scale structure of the Universe, we have developed a high-precision theoretical template for next-generation galaxy surveys. Implementing a fast calculation method for perturbation theory, the cosmological data analysis tool was exploited. Applying it to the existing cosmological data set, robust cosmological test of gravity has been made, and a tight constraint on the cosmic expansion has been obtained.
